About The Position

The Compliance Officer independently manages and conducts enforcement operations to combat illegal hunting and promote compliance with NSW hunting, biosecurity, forestry and similiar legislation. The role investigates breaches whilst educating the public, liaising with stakeholders, and maintaining accurate records.

Requirements

  • Proven ability to work independently and manage diverse enforcement workloads
  • Experience planning and conducting regulatory operations and investigations
  • Strong communication and advisory skills, particularly in explaining complex regulations
  • Demonstrated sound judgment and problem-solving in challenging field environments
  • Proficiency in IT systems for record-keeping and operational planning
  • Current NSW Driver Licence and the ability and willingness to travel regularly.
